Abstract

This diploma thesis focuses on the design of the exterior and interior of an autonomous rail vehicle intended for urban public transportation. The creative process concentrates on the shaping of the vehicle’s front section, including the lighting design, the interior layout, seat design, and visual communication with passengers. The thesis includes re-search in the fields of rail vehicle design, engineering, ergonomics, and aerodynamics. Particular em-phasis is placed on autonomous driving, safety features, operational infrastructure, information systems, accessibility and ergonomics for passengers with disabilities, and sustainable materials. The design development process is carried out through sketches, virtual models, physical scale models, and CAD systems, supplemented by a somatographic study, visualizations, and technical documentation. Finally, a RULA analysis of a selected section of the tram was conducted, together with the creation of a physical model in an appropriate scale.
